Feliz Día de los Muertos

 

Día de los Muertos, an important festival in Azteca’s culture, the Day of the Dead, was fast approaching and the Vatos were very excited for this day of celebration of life and death, but more importantly the festivities that would ensue! Celebrating life and death is very important to the Azeteca’s traditions and culture, bringing these wonderful traditions from their hometowns in Mexico up to Los Santos. Sure, the theme is death, but the point is to demonstrate love and respect for deceased family members. In towns and cities throughout Mexico, revelers don funky makeup and costumes, hold parades and parties, sing and dance, and make offerings to lost loved ones.
